Establishment of diplomatic relations between the Republic of Tajikistan and the Central African Republic
DUSHANBE, 16.02.2018. /NIAT “Khovar”/. A signing ceremony of the Joint Communiqué on the establishment of diplomatic relations between the Republic of Tajikistan and the Central African Republic was held on February 15 in New York. NIAT “Khovar” has been reported by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Tajikistan.
According to the source, the Permanent Representatives of the Republic of Tajikistan and the Central African Republic to the United Nations – Mahmadamin Mahmadaminov and Ms. Ambroisine Kpongo to this effect, signed the Joint Communiqué.
